Ultimate Guide to 10 Wt Fly Reel Performance
Selecting the perfect fly reel for a 10 weight rod can be tricky. You want something that can handle powerful casts and strong fighting fish, but also feels comfortable in your hand. A good 10 wt reel 12 ft rod and reel combo should provide smooth drag performance, reliable braking systems, and durable construction to withstand the rigors of big game fishing. Consider factors like spool size, weight capacity, retrieve speed, and materials when making your choice. Understanding these elements will help you find a reel that's truly built for the task at hand and will enhance your fly fishing adventures.
Here are some key points to keep in mind:
- Spool Size: A larger spool capacity is essential for holding substantial backing and line, crucial when battling larger fish.
- Drag System: Look for a smooth and adjustable drag system that allows you to adjust the resistance based on the size and strength of the fish you're targeting.
- Material: Reels are often made from aluminum, titanium, or composite materials. Each offers its own benefits in terms of weight, durability, and corrosion resistance.
With careful consideration and research, you can select a 10 wt fly reel that will be your trusted partner for years to come.
